Maitland Secondary School, formerly known as Maitland Boys' High School,is a school in the Western Cape. It has been a state high school since 1884, and can trace its history as a private school decades further back into the nineteenth century.
The school moved to its current site in 1891 with a single storey classroom block and the two-storey Principal's residence and hostel for boarders, known as “Hinder House”.
The school went co-educational in 1987, welcoming in the first cohorts of female students.

The Maitland Gaol, also known as Maitland Correctional Centre, is a heritage-listed former Australian prison located in East Maitland, New South Wales. Its construction was started in 1844 and prisoners first entered the gaol in 1848. By the time of its closure, on 31 January 1998, it had become the longest continuously-run gaol in Australia. It has since been turned into a museum and is a popular tourist attraction. It was added to the New South Wales State Heritage Register on 2 April 1999.

Maitland Post Office is a heritage-listed post office at 381 High Street, Maitland, City of Maitland, New South Wales, Australia. It was designed by the NSW Colonial Architect's Office under James Barnet and built in 1881. The property is owned by Australia Post. It was added to the New South Wales State Heritage Register on 17 December 1999.

Aberglasslyn House is a heritage-listed residence and former boarding school at Aberglasslyn Road, Aberglasslyn, City of Maitland, New South Wales, Australia. It was designed by John Verge and built from 1840 to 1842. It is also known as Aberglasslyn and Aberglasslyn Homestead. It was added to the New South Wales State Heritage Register on 2 April 1999.
